> This should demonstrate that OverflowError will not disappear entirely
> even in Python 3.

No one is denying that by now :)

> Even if we were to get rid of all OverflowErrors resulting from integer
> operations in Python, there are going to be some C extensions--including
> some in the Python standard library--that will store 32-bit integers.
> Modules such as array and struct will still raise it, and probably other
> modules were a long integer sometimes doesn't make sense (socket, for
> instance).  itertools.count() should work for arbitrary integers, though.
